What Is Rollup-as-a-Service (RaaS)?
Rollup-as-a-Service (RaaS) is an infrastructure service of the next generation that seeks to simplify the deployment and management of rollup chains — a powerful Layer 2 scaling solution.
In simple terms, RaaS enables developers, startups, and corporations to build bespoke rollup-based blockchains without the need for deep technical knowledge. The platforms eliminate the intricacies of setting up rollups, providing plug-and-play tools, APIs, and automation features.
Rollups combine (or "roll up") multiple off-chain transactions and submit them as a batch to the primary blockchain (Layer 1), greatly reducing congestion and gas prices.
How Do Rollups Work?
Rollups are Layer 2 scaling solutions that process transactions off the primary blockchain but with the same security needs as the Layer 1 upon which they are built.
There are largely two types of rollups:
Optimistic Rollups: Assume all transactions are correct until they're proven incorrect, which supports high efficiency.
Zero-Knowledge (ZK) Rollups: Employ crypto proofs to verify transaction correctness before committing them to Layer 1, allowing for faster finality and security.
Both technologies aim at speeding up transaction throughput, reducing fees, and maintaining blockchain integrity — making them key foundational blocks for scalability.
Why Are RaaS Platforms Becoming Popular?
It requires deep technical knowledge, outrageous development prices, and significant amounts of time to develop a rollup chain from scratch. RaaS platforms eliminate all these barriers by offering plug-and-play scalability solutions for blockchain projects.
The following are the reasons why they are dominating as the backbone of today's blockchain infrastructure:
Ease of Deployment: Developers can deploy custom rollups in minutes without complex coding.
Customization: Choose optimistic or ZK rollups, data availability layers, and governance models.
Lower costs: Lower-cost transactions and deployment compared to isolated blockchains.
Interoperability: Be easily connectable with other chains, enabling cross-chain use cases.
Security: Have the security of the parent Layer 1 chain (e.g., Ethereum).
